Interface IWDFDriver (wudfddi.h)
[Aviso: UMDF 2 é a versão mais recente do UMDF e substitui UMDF 1. Todos os novos drivers UMDF devem ser gravados usando UMDF 2. Nenhum novo recurso está sendo adicionado ao UMDF 1 e há suporte limitado para UMDF 1 em versões mais recentes do Windows 10. Os drivers universais do Windows devem usar o UMDF 2. Para obter mais informações, consulte Introdução com UMDF.]
A interface IWDFDriver expõe o objeto de driver de estrutura que representa a imagem do driver carregada no processo do host.
Herança
A interface IWDFDriver herda de IWDFObject. O IWDFDriver também tem estes tipos de membros:
- Métodos
Métodos
A interface IWDFDriver tem esses métodos.
IWDFDriver::CreateDevice O método CreateDevice configura e cria um novo objeto de dispositivo de estrutura. |
IWDFDriver::CreatePreallocatedWdfMemory O método CreatePreallocatedWdfMemory cria um objeto de memória de estrutura para o buffer especificado. |
IWDFDriver::CreateWdfMemory O método CreateWdfMemory cria um objeto de memória de estrutura e aloca, para o objeto de memória, um buffer de dados do tamanho diferente de zero especificado. |
IWDFDriver::CreateWdfObject O método CreateWdfObject cria um objeto WDF personalizado (ou usuário) de um objeto WDF pai. |
IWDFDriver::IsVersionAvailable O método IsVersionAvailable determina se a versão especificada da estrutura está disponível. |
IWDFDriver::RetrieveVersionString O método RetrieveVersionString recupera a versão da estrutura. |
Requisitos
Requisito | Valor |
---|---|
Fim do suporte | Indisponível no UMDF 2.0 e posterior. |
Plataforma de Destino | Área de Trabalho |
Versão mínima do UMDF | 1.5 |
Cabeçalho | wudfddi.h |